Specifications
Current - Output (Max): 2.5A
Base Part Number: VE-JTM
Size / Dimension: 2.28" L x 1.86" W x 1.04" H (57.9mm x 47.2mm x 26.4mm)
Package / Case: Half Brick
Mounting Type: Through Hole
Efficiency: 90%
Operating Temperature: -40°C ~ 100°C
Features: OCP, SCP
Applications: ITE (Commercial)
Voltage - Isolation: 3kV
Power (Watts): 25W
Series: VE-J00™
Voltage - Output 3: --
Voltage - Output 2: --
Voltage - Output 1: 10V
Voltage - Input (Max): 160V
Voltage - Input (Min): 66V
Number of Outputs: 1
Type: Isolated Module
Part Status: Active
Packaging: Bulk
